DAC7617U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The DAC7617U is a 12-bit digital-to-analog converter manufactured by Texas Instruments, featuring 4 independent D/A converters in a 16-SOIC surface mount package. This component is classified as obsolete, making equivalent substitute parts necessary for ongoing production and maintenance applications. The DAC7617U provides voltage-buffered output with SPI data interface and external reference capability, suitable for precision analog signal generation in embedded systems and instrumentation.

Key Parameters

Parameter Value
Manufacturer Part Number DAC7617U
Manufacturer Texas Instruments
Number of Bits 12
Number of D/A Converters 4
Output Type Voltage - Buffered
Data Interface SPI
Settling Time 10µs
Architecture R-2R
Package / Case 16-SOIC (0.295", 7.50mm Width)
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Operating Temperature Range -40°C ~ 85°C
Voltage - Supply, Analog 3V ~ 3.6V
Voltage - Supply, Digital 3V ~ 3.6V
Product Status Obsolete

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ution of the DAC7617U is based on strict equivalence of the following critical parameters:

  • Resolution: 12-bit digital input
  • Converter Count: 4 independent D/A converters
  • Output Configuration: Voltage-buffered output
  • Serial Interface: SPI protocol compatibility
  • Package Type: 16-SOIC surface mount form factor
  • Supply Voltage Ranges: 3V to 3.6V for both analog and digital supplies
  • Temperature Operating Range: -40°C to 85°C
  • Architecture: R-2R ladder network

The DAC7617UB qualifies as a direct substitute based on matching all critical electrical and mechanical parameters. The primary distinction is product status: DAC7617UB is active production, whereas DAC7617U is obsolete.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The DAC7617UB is the direct substitute for DAC7617U applications. Selection is based on the following factors:

Product Status: DAC7617U is obsolete; DAC7617UB is in active production. For new designs and ongoing production, DAC7617UB ensures long-term component availability and supply chain continuity.

Compliance & Certifications: Both parts maintain identical RoHS3 compliance, REACH unaffected status, and moisture sensitivity ratings. No compliance degradation occurs with substitution.

Electrical Performance: DAC7617UB demonstrates improved linearity specifications (INL/DNL ±1 Max vs. ±2/±1 Max), providing equal or superior performance in precision analog applications.

Mechanical & Thermal Compatibility: Identical 16-SOIC package, mounting type, and operating temperature range ensure direct board-level compatibility without layout or thermal management modifications.

Packaging Consideration: DAC7617UB is supplied in tube packaging, whereas DAC7617U packaging is unspecified. Verify tape-and-reel availability if automated assembly processes require specific packaging formats.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can DAC7617UB directly replace DAC7617U in existing designs?

A: Yes. DAC7617UB is electrically and mechanically equivalent to DAC7617U. No circuit modifications, PCB layout changes, or firmware updates are required. Pin configuration, signal timing, and supply voltage requirements are identical.

Q: What is the primary reason for substitution?

A: DAC7617U is obsolete. DAC7617UB is the active production equivalent from Texas Instruments, ensuring component availability for current and future production runs.

Q: Are there differences in linearity performance?

A: DAC7617UB specifies ±1 LSB maximum for both INL and DNL, compared to DAC7617U's ±2 LSB INL specification. This represents improved or equivalent performance and does not restrict substitution.

Q: Does packaging differ between these parts?

A: DAC7617UB is supplied in tube packaging. DAC7617U packaging is not specified in available documentation. Confirm packaging requirements for your assembly process before procurement.

Q: Are both parts RoHS and REACH compliant?

A: Yes. Both DAC7617U and DAC7617UB are ROHS3 compliant and REACH unaffected, meeting environmental and regulatory requirements for EU and global markets.

Q: What is the moisture sensitivity level?

A: Both parts carry MSL 3 rating with 168-hour floor life. Standard moisture control procedures during storage and assembly apply to both components.

Q: Is the SPI interface identical between parts?

A: Yes. Both parts implement SPI data interface with identical protocol, timing, and signal requirements. No firmware or driver modifications are necessary.
